As a Talent Manager at Scede, you will either be embedded into one of our live customers, simultaneously owning the day to day operations of our engagement and delivering against our customer's hiring plan.

As our next Talent Manager, you'll have:





A strong track record of achievement in end-to-end recruitment within the tech and/or commercial space Previous accountability for the leadership and performance of a team either directly or indirectly managing other recruiters Exceptional communication and collaboration skills, and the ability to build strong relationships A real appreciation for data and recruiting metrics and experience using these to continuously improve A can-do, positive attitude towards overcoming challenges and finding solutions, with an 'always learning' mentality An agile approach to work, even when working remotely


As a Talent Manager, you can expect to:





Lead from the front as a player-coach. You'll manage the operational performance of your team and ensure we live and breathe our Scede values Set and clearly communicate the goals and expectations of your team whilst fostering a management style of empowerment and trust Work closely with hiring managers and teams to create a streamlined and unbiased recruitment process that follows best practices Own the recruitment journey and all aspects of the candidate experience - sourcing, screening, and guiding great people through the process Be creative with sourcing techniques and continuously seek ways to improve Guide your stakeholders through key initiatives including; code reviews, conducting interview training, employer branding, and the development of D&I processes Monitor and report on key talent acquisition metrics, using data to influence decisions Actively contribute to your project team rituals and across Scede, coaching and perhaps mentoring others


Perks of working as a Talent Manager at Scede:





The autonomy, trust, and flexibility of a 100% remote-first company. You're empowered to work from home or wherever you feel you work best. We've found that a positive work-life balance for all is much more accessible this way. Private medical and dental cover. Discounts and perks across retail, travel, leisure, and entertainment through our benefits platform "Ben" via "Perks at Work". Monthly "Best Self" allowance to invest in something that works for you, such as subscriptions to Spotify or Audible, gym memberships, a meal at your favourite restaurant, and more. On top of 23 days of paid leave (pro rata), you also have your birthday off to celebrate, and 3 extra days off between Christmas and New Year.
